Day 294: Judea Gains Independence (2025)

Fr. Mike dives into the establishment of an independent Israel as Simon takes charge against Trifo's threats. He highlights Simon's military victories and the restoration of law and order in Judea. The discussion moves to practical wisdom in community life, featuring insights on hospitality and humility from Sirach. Additionally, there's a cautionary note about envy and excess from Proverbs. Ultimately, it emphasizes the importance of belonging to God and the significance of a Christian theocracy.

Day 291: The Rise of King Alexander (2025)

Fr. Mike delves into the rise of Jonathan as high priest amid political intrigue. He details Alexander's tactical victory over Demetrius and highlights the significant alliance formed through Alexander's marriage to Cleopatra. The discussion extends to the moral lessons from Sirach, emphasizing the character of spouses applicable to everyone. Fr. Mike also warns against the dangers of pursuing wealth as outlined in Proverbs, offering deeper reflections on life's challenges.
